However, what makes the Acemate truly fascinating is its unique approach to tennis training. It collects your shots, using cameras to line up the ball and then swiftly intercepting it with a sweeping curve. This innovative design creates a challenging and dynamic training environment, pushing players to their limits.
One of the most intriguing aspects of the Acemate is its ability to simulate the rhythm of a normal rally. Unlike other hi-tech practice partners, the Acemate ensures that each shot is followed by another, creating a continuous flow that mirrors a real match. This feature is particularly useful for improving consistency and maintaining a steady pace, which are essential skills in tennis.
However, the Acemate is not without its weaknesses. Its performance is highly dependent on weather conditions, and it is best left inside when it's raining. This limitation highlights the importance of environmental factors in AI-powered sports equipment. Additionally, the Acemate's relentless pursuit of the ball can be exhausting, especially for older players like me. The constant need to shuttle left and right to the corners of the court adds a physical challenge that may not be suitable for everyone.
Despite these limitations, the Acemate offers a unique training experience. Its ability to provide feedback and assess a player's performance is invaluable. The AI-enabled assessment, though gently condescending, offers insights into areas that need improvement. This feature is particularly useful for players who want to focus on specific aspects of their game, making it more akin to a coach than a rival.
In comparison, the Pongbot Pace S Pro, a Chinese-made alternative, lacks the Acemate's wow-factor but comes at a more affordable price. The Pongbot also has wheels, but they are only used to push it onto the court, where it rotates on its base like a hi-tech cannon. This design allows for precise ball placement, making it a versatile training tool.
